Lions Easter Egg Hunt moves to King Park

The annual Calico Rock Lions Club sponsored Easter Egg Hunt will be held this coming Saturday, April 19th.  Due to the recent flooding in Rand Park, the community event has been moved to Earl King Park off Hwy 56 behind the Fire Department.  Area youngsters are invited to participate, with the hunt beginning at 10:00 AM.  Remember to bring your own Easter basket to collect your eggs.  Prizes will be awarded to those who find the “prize eggs” that will be among the 1500 eggs that are to be hidden. There will be two age groups as follows: 4 and under and 5 and above.  Come on out and join the fun with the Lions!
